Tell the World
The world says that they are okay,
Without faith.
But it doesn't look that way,
Every time they break.
I want to show them that they can saved,
But that would cause me hate.
I'd be labeled a
HYPOCRITE
BIGOT
FOOL.
Because I believe in something that appears to be impossible,
The fact that God can't fit into a box makes Him implausible.
I want this world to know that it has kept me silent for far too long,
I need to rely on my faith so that I can finally stand strong.
I'm gonna tell the world.
